**Runbook: account recovery — FeeForge rules engine**

If the FeeForge admin account gets locked mid-release (it happens, usually during shipping-fee rule pushes), don't panic. First verify the requester with the on-call lead from the Saltmere team, then open the sealed recovery envelope in the vault tooling. The unlock flow will prompt you for the passphrase recorded directly below.

vault phrase of kawep-tahog = ulaix-briath

Subject: On-call handover — Rotavault notes

Hi, welcome aboard. Rotavault is our secrets-rotation utility; it runs nightly and rotates credentials for most internal services. During your shift, watch for stuck rotation jobs — they must be cleared within four hours or downstream tokens expire. The runbook covers manual re-runs step by step. For anything ambiguous, or if a rotation touches the billing cluster, contact the Rotavault maintainers directly at the address below.

billing contact of yawip-yadup = druath.casdor@nelvrolabs.internal

**Audit item 12 — Occupancy feed integrity**

Verify that the Kerbstone garage occupancy feed rejects negative counts, caps values at the configured stall total, and flags readings older than ten minutes as stale. Confirm the nightly reconciliation job logs discrepancies rather than silently correcting them. Document any deviation in the audit ledger. Questions about historical calibration decisions should be directed to the owner recorded below.

named custodian: Brivan Eliath Quenox Frador

Handover: Veldt retention sweeper

For your review: the sweeper deletes expired records nightly, honoring legal-hold flags before any purge. Deletions are tombstoned for thirty days and logged to the audit stream. I verified hold checks run ahead of batch selection, not after. The sweeper's current production configuration, relevant to your assessment, is reproduced below.

settings of fafog-haduf:
ZORIX_PIN=4648
ZORIX_METRICS_HOST=metrics.zorix.paliqsys.corp
ZORIX_LOG_LEVEL=info
ZORIX_TENANT=druix